Luxor and Aswan are two of Egypt’s most iconic destinations, both located along the Nile River and rich in history. Many travelers planning a trip to Egypt often ask the same question: should I visit Luxor or Aswan?

While both cities offer unforgettable experiences, they are very different in atmosphere, attractions, and pace. This comparison will help you decide which destination suits your travel style best.
Historical Attractions
Luxor is often described as the world’s greatest open-air museum. It is home to iconic sites such as Karnak Temple, Luxor Temple, the Valley of the Kings, and the Temple of Hatshepsut. If ancient Egyptian history and monumental temples are your priority, Luxor offers a denser concentration of world-famous sites.

Aswan, while still rich in history, focuses more on Nubian culture and scenic temples like Philae Temple. The historical sites in Aswan are fewer but beautifully set along the Nile.

Atmosphere and Scenery
Luxor feels grand, busy, and deeply historical. The city revolves around its temples and archaeological sites.
Aswan, on the other hand, is calmer and more relaxed, known for its islands, palm-lined riverbanks, and peaceful felucca sailing.
Things to Do
In Luxor, activities revolve around temple exploration, guided tours, hot air balloon rides, and visiting royal tombs.
In Aswan, travelers enjoy Nile sailing, Nubian village visits, and quiet cultural experiences.
Which Is Better for First-Time Visitors?
For first-time visitors to Egypt, Luxor is usually the better choice due to its concentration of major attractions and structured sightseeing options.
Aswan is ideal as a second stop or as part of a longer itinerary.
